Raufarhólshellir, located in Iceland, is a breathtaking lava tunnel that offers tourists a unique glimpse into the natural wonders created by volcanic activity. With its stunning formations and rich geological history, it is a must-visit destination for nature enthusiasts and adventurers alike.

Walking
From the center of Hveragerdi, head east on Þjóðvegur 1 (the main road). Continue walking for about 2 kilometers until you reach the fork in the road. Take the right fork onto Road 37, which is signposted for Raufarhólshellir. Follow this road for another 1.5 kilometers. You will see signs for Raufarhólshellir indicating the entrance. The cave is located just off the road and is easily accessible on foot.
Biking
If you have access to a bicycle, start from the center of Hveragerdi and head east on Þjóðvegur 1. After about 2 kilometers, look for the right fork onto Road 37. Continue biking for approximately 1.5 kilometers. Look for the signs leading to Raufarhólshellir. The bike ride is scenic and will take around 15-20 minutes, depending on your pace.
Public Transport (Bus)
Catch the bus from the main bus stop in Hveragerdi. Look for a bus heading towards Selfoss or Þorlákshöfn. Get off at the stop labeled 'Raufarhólshellir'. From the bus stop, it is a short 500-meter walk to the entrance of the cave. Follow the signs pointing towards Raufarhólshellir.
